Key Features of Travel Expense Apps
When considering a business travel expense app, it’s essential to evaluate the key features that can significantly enhance usability and efficiency. One prominent feature is automated expense reporting. This functionality allows users to streamline their expense submission process, minimizing manual entry and the possibility of errors. Automation ensures that expenses are captured accurately and submitted in real-time, allowing for quicker reimbursements and budget tracking.
Another critical feature to look for is receipt scanning. This element enables users to scan receipts digitally, instantly converting them into readable data. By employing optical character recognition (OCR), the app reduces the need for paper storage and simplifies the entry of expenses. Users can also categorize and annotate these scanned receipts, making record-keeping more organized and efficient.
Multi-currency support is particularly beneficial for businesses with international operations. An effective travel expense app should automatically convert expenses into the company’s primary currency, providing clarity and consistency in financial reporting. This functionality also aids in better budgeting and expenditure tracking across different regions.
Integration with accounting software is another crucial feature that enhances the app’s functionality. Seamless integration ensures that all expenses are automatically synced into the company’s financial systems, eliminating the need for manual data entry. This capability not only saves time but also enhances accuracy, providing a comprehensive overview of financial health.
Policy compliance checks are invaluable for maintaining adherence to company travel policies. A robust app should have features that automatically flag non-compliant expenses, helping users stay aligned with corporate guidelines. This reduces the risk of overspending and promotes a culture of accountability within the organization.
Finally, real-time analytics provides businesses with insightful data on travel spending. By analyzing trends and patterns, companies can make informed decisions about their travel policies, negotiate better deals, and ultimately save on travel costs. With these key features in mind, businesses can choose an expense app that not only meets their needs but also enhances their overall travel experience.

Top Business Travel Expense Apps on the Market
In the rapidly evolving landscape of business travel, utilizing a reliable business travel expense app has become essential for organizations seeking efficiency and accuracy. Several applications have distinguished themselves through unique features, pricing models, user experiences, and target audiences. Below is a comparison of some of the leading travel expense apps currently available.
One prominent option is Expensify. Renowned for its user-friendly interface, it offers features such as automatic receipt scanning and real-time expense reporting, making it particularly appealing for small to medium-sized enterprises. Expensify operates on a subscription basis, with pricing tiers designed to accommodate varying business sizes and needs.
Another noteworthy app is Certify. This app stands out for its comprehensive reporting capabilities and customizable workflows. Its mobile app streamlines travel expense submissions, allowing users to capture receipts on-the-go. Certify’s pricing model is competitive, aiming to cater to businesses ranging from startups to larger corporations, thus enhancing appeal.
Zoho Expense offers a compelling blend of automation and integration. Known for its seamless connection with other Zoho products, it includes features like invoice creation and multi-currency capability, making it ideal for companies engaging in international travel. Zoho Expense employs a flexible pricing structure, enabling customization based on specific requirements.
Finally, TravelBank combines travel booking and expense management within a single platform. It provides businesses with a holistic view of travel expenditures while offering expense tracking and budget management features. The cost-effective nature of TravelBank aligns well with startups and mid-sized businesses, promoting efficiency in expense management.
These business travel expense apps offer varying features and pricing structures, allowing companies to choose one that best aligns with their needs and operational style. As businesses continue to adapt to the demands of modern travel, leveraging such applications can lead to improved expense management and heightened productivity.

Implementing Travel Expense Apps: Best Practices
Successful implementation of a business travel expense app is crucial for optimizing travel management processes within an organization. By focusing on several best practices, companies can facilitate a smoother transition and gain maximum benefits from the application.
First and foremost, effective change management is essential. This involves preparing staff for the upcoming changes by communicating the reasons for adopting a new travel expense app. Engaging employees early in the process can help address any concerns and promote a positive outlook towards the new system. It is advisable to create a detailed timeline and gradually introduce different features of the app, allowing employees to acclimate to the new tools.
Staff training is another critical component that should not be overlooked. Comprehensive training sessions tailored to various employee roles will ensure everyone understands how to utilize the travel expense app effectively. Utilizing a variety of training methods, such as live demonstrations, video tutorials, and written guides, can accommodate different learning preferences and enhance user confidence. Furthermore, appointing ‘champions’ or super-users among staff members can aid in encouraging adoption and providing peer support.
Integration with existing systems is another vital aspect of successful implementation. The chosen business travel expense app should seamlessly connect with payroll, accounting, and other relevant software, minimizing disruptions and ensuring data accuracy. Conducting thorough compatibility assessments before selecting a travel expense app can prevent potential integration problems later on.
Finally, ongoing support strategies must be established to assist employees as they adapt to the new app. Providing readily accessible resources, such as help desks, FAQs, and feedback mechanisms, can foster user confidence and promote continuous improvement. Ensuring that employees feel supported throughout the adoption process will not only enhance user satisfaction but also encourage greater compliance with the organization’s travel expense policies.

Common Challenges and Solutions in Using Expense Apps
Adopting a business travel expense app can streamline processes and enhance financial oversight for companies; however, several challenges may arise during implementation. One common issue is user resistance, where employees may be hesitant to adopt new technology due to comfort with traditional methods. To mitigate this challenge, organizations should invest in comprehensive training sessions. Equipping employees with the necessary skills and knowledge enhances their confidence and promotes smoother transitions.
An additional challenge often encountered is data entry errors. Inaccuracies in expense reporting can lead to financial discrepancies and undermine the overall reliability of the business travel expense app. Businesses can address this challenge by incorporating automated data capture features such as receipt scanning. Many modern expense apps enable users to take photographs of receipts, reducing the likelihood of manual entry errors significantly. Furthermore, fostering a culture of diligence around expense reporting can create accountability among team members.
Integration with existing financial systems is another hurdle companies may face. If the business travel expense app does not synchronize effectively with current accounting tools, it can result in duplication of work and potential data inconsistencies. To overcome this challenge, selecting an expense app that boasts robust integration capabilities is crucial. Before implementation, businesses should also seek reviews and conduct thorough assessments on compatibility with their existing systems.
Lastly, companies may encounter resistance from upper management regarding the overall investment in the travel expense app. To alleviate concerns, organizations should prepare a detailed business case showcasing the potential return on investment (ROI) and improved operational efficiency. Highlighting case studies or testimonials from other users can further support the decision-making process. By proactively addressing these challenges, businesses can ensure a smoother transition to utilizing a business travel expense app effectively.
